WARNING

  1. Do not load winch beyond its rated capacity. Capacity rating is based on one layer of line around the drum. As line builds on drum, capacity decreases. Obtain cable and rope manufacturers recommendation for size and type.
  2. Do not use winch for lifting people or loads over people.
  3. Learn to use your winch. After installing your winch, take the time to practice using it so that you are comfortable with it when the need arises. Periodically, check the winch installation to assure that all bolts are tight.
  4. If used as a vehicle winch, do not “move” your vehicle to assist the winch. The combination of the winch and the vehicle pulling together could overload the cable.
  5. Keep winch area clear. Do not allow people to remain in the winch area. Do not stand between the winch and the load.
  6. Inspect cable frequently. A frayed cable, or rope with broken strands should be replaced immediately. Do not operate winch if line is kinked, or shows any signs of corrosion, or weakness.
  7. Keep hands and fingers clear of the winch and cable when using the winch.
  8. Always check for correct direction of rotation before using the winch.
  9. Do not hold a load on a trailer with winch cable. Tie down ropes or straps must be used to secure a load to the trailer.
  10. Never hook the cable back onto itself, use a sling. Hooking the cable onto itself creates an unacceptable strain on the cable. (See Fig. A)
  11. It is a good idea to lay a heavy blanket or jacket over the cable about 15 feet from the hook end when pulling in severe conditions. If a cable failure should occur, the weight of the cloth will act as a damper and prevent broken cable from whipping.
  12. Avoid pulls from extreme angles. This may damage the cable and winch drum.
  13. Never install winch in such a way that the warning and direction labels are obscured. Someone who has not read this manual may need to see them to understand the proper operation of the winch.
  14. Do not attach winch to objects of unknown carrying capacity which may cause it to break loose during operation.
  15. Operate winch by hand power only.
  16. Always keep a minimum of four coils of cable on the drum for safe operation. This will supply friction for a proper anchor; otherwise the cable, or rope may pull loose from the drum.
  17. Failure to comply with all of these warnings may cause serious injury and /or damage to property.

Installation Instructions

The mounting location for the winch must be capable of handling the loads of the job you intend the winch to do. The winch may be mounted in any position as long as the operator will be standing in a comfortable position with unobstructed access to and a clear view of the winch and cable.

Do not mount the winch where it has the possibility of getting wet or submerged in water.

Use 3/8″ diameter mounting hardware (i.e. bolts, flat washers, lock washers and nuts) of sufficient strength that is equal to or exceeds the capacity of the winch.

Before Installing Cable

The winch must be tested for proper operation before installing cable:

  1. Attach the handle to the pinion gear shaft on the GPW-1000, GPW-1200 and GPW-1400 with one nyloc nut. Attach the handle for GPW-2000 and GPW-2500 by pressing the spring loaded clip and sliding the handle on to the pinion gear shaft.
  2. As you turn the handle, a noticeable clicking sound should be heard.
  3. Flip the pawl back and forth to make sure the spring is functioning and the pawl makes contact with the gear teeth.

The GPW-2000 and GPW-2500 have two pinion gear shafts for different speeds. Move the handle to the location that makes the job easiest.

Operation

WARNING
Never fully extend the rope, or cable while under load.
Failure to comply may cause serious injury and/or property damage!

  1. Keep hands away from load bearing cables, ropes, sheaves, drums and pulleys while operating.
  2. Keep rope, or cable properly aligned on the drum.
  3. Keep moving parts including gears, ratchets and shafts clean and lubricated to insure proper and safe operation.
